Today is the last chance for states to tell the Health and Human Services Department whether they want to have any role in planning the health insurance marketplaces that are set to open for enrollment in October. INFO RECORD-BREAKING RECOVERIES FROM HEALTH FRAUD INVESTIGATIONS NJ writes, “For every dollar spent on health care-related fraud and abuse investigations in the last three years, the government recovered $7.90, according to a new report from the departments of HHS and Justice. The government teams recovered $4.2 billion in FY 2012, ROI was the highest in the history of the Health Care Fraud and Abuse program.”
